Output ec63d717397995d181229058f3b545322d7d74c723f3c972a1a202ae496b3c91:22

value
4886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3c26709fd7ff73c305153f07f0c605e68942c327b5764103249cc6ca26afb4e
address
bc1pk0pxwz0a0lmncvz320c87rrqte5fgtpj0dtkgypjf8xxegn2ld8qhws08x
transaction
ec63d717397995d181229058f3b545322d7d74c723f3c972a1a202ae496b3c91
spent
true